    Abstract: Provided is a method for transmitting, by a user equipment (UE), a demodulation reference signal (DMRS) for a physical uplink shared channel (PUSCH) in a wireless communication system. A terminal receives a cyclic shift field, which indicates a first value and a second value, through a physical downlink control channel (PDCCH) from a base station, generates a first DMRS sequence and a second DMRS sequence, which are associated with a first layer and a second layer respectively, by using a first cyclic shift and a second cyclic shift, respectively, which are determined based on the first value and the second value respectively, and transmits the first DMRS sequence and the second DMRS sequence to the base station. Furthermore, the first value and the second value are separated by a maximum value corresponding to a total number of possible cyclic shifts.

    Abstract: A method for transmitting, by a user equipment (UE), an aperiodic sounding reference signal (SRS) in a wireless communication system, the method including receiving, via a physical downlink control channel (PDCCH), downlink control information (DCI) for downlink scheduling. The DCI includes an SRS request for triggering transmission of the aperiodic SRS. The method further includes detecting the SRS request; and transmitting the aperiodic SRS on an uplink (UL) component carrier (CC), which is linked to a downlink (DL) CC in which a physical downlink shared channel (PDSCH) is scheduled by the DCI, among a plurality of UL CCs. If a carrier indicator field (CIF) is configured, the UL CC is indicated by the CIF.
